How to Create a 3D Model of Mitosis: A Quick Guide to Building Your Mitosis Model in Minutes
Creating a 3D model of mitosis is a rewarding project that helps visualize the cell division process. Mitosis is crucial for growth and repair in living organisms, making it a popular topic for biology students. In this guide, we will walk you through the steps to construct an informative and engaging 3D model of mitosis.
To start, gather your materials. You will need some colorful playdough or clay to represent different cell components. Specifically, choose colors that will differentiate between the cell membrane, chromosomes, and the spindle fibers. Having a sturdy base, such as a piece of cardboard or a foam board, will also be beneficial.
Step 1: Prepare Your Base
Begin by cutting your cardboard into a manageable size for displaying your model. Make sure it is sturdy enough to hold the clay components. You might want to paint it to represent the cytoplasm or simply leave it flat and color the base later.
Step 2: Creating the Cell Membrane
Using your clay or playdough, form a large circle to represent the cell membrane. The cell membrane is crucial as it encloses the cell's contents. Choose colors that stand out against the base, as this will help viewers easily identify the parts of your model.
Step 3: Building the Chromosomes
Next, create the chromosomes. During mitosis, they take on a distinct X shape. Roll your clay into small tubes, then twist each one to form the characteristic shape of chromosomes. Keep them in pairs to illustrate the sister chromatids that will separate during the cell division process.
Step 4: Forming the Spindle Fibers
Spindle fibers are necessary for pulling the chromosomes apart during mitosis. Cut thin strips of clay or string and position them emanating from a central point, representing the spindle apparatus. These fibers will connect to the chromosomes to illustrate how the cell ensures each new cell receives the correct genetic material.
Step 5: Showcasing Each Mitosis Stage
To fully represent mitosis, consider creating separate sections on your base for each phase: prophase, metaphase, anaphase, and telophase. Use a small sign or label made from paper to indicate the different stages of cell division. This will help to make your model more educational and interactive.
Final Touches
Once all components are in place, step back and review your work. Make any necessary adjustments to ensure everything is easily distinguishable. Adding color labels or brief descriptions alongside each phase can enhance understanding for viewers. Lastly, consider taking pictures of each stage of your model as it is a great way to document your effort!
